    Re: 8/2/15 Reds vs Pirates

    Quote Originally Posted by TheTimeIsNow View Post
    People like to throw those stats on the table but they never say anything about the fact that since 2012, the Pirates have been hit more than they have hit the opponent.
    True, but that is a chicken or an egg thing. Simple fact is more teams (mostly AL) hit more players than ever, only 90 teams have ever hit 70 batters in a season, ten of them predate 1996. The rest are a by product of the steroid era, increased protection and a tighter strike zone. The three teams that show up the most on the Rays, Red Sox and Phillies. The Pirates are about to make their 6th season on the list, the list is about 65% AL teams so it's natural that the NL teams fans are going to going to point their fingers at the NL teams that make up the rest of that list.
